From f030f31d92528ecfee47caf3f4da2b4e19d8dd59 Mon Sep 17 00:00:00 2001 From: yah01 Date: Tue, 9 Jan 2024 15:36:47 +0800 Subject: [PATCH] enhance: make the error of parsing expression to `ParameterInvalid` (#29681) before this, the error is unexpected error Signed-off-by: yah01 --- internal/proxy/task_search.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/internal/proxy/task_search.go b/internal/proxy/task_search.go index e1ea686c1b..8f1c3fd203 100644 --- a/internal/proxy/task_search.go +++ b/internal/proxy/task_search.go @@ -342,7 +342,7 @@ func (t *searchTask) PreExecute(ctx context.Context) error { log.Warn("failed to create query plan", zap.Error(err), zap.String("dsl", t.request.Dsl), // may be very large if large term passed. zap.String("anns field", annsField), zap.Any("query info", queryInfo)) - return fmt.Errorf("failed to create query plan: %v", err) + return merr.WrapErrParameterInvalidMsg("failed to create query plan: %v", err) } log.Debug("create query plan", zap.String("dsl", t.request.Dsl), // may be very large if large term passed.